144th FW flies high in Nellis skies
A U.S. Air Force F-15C Eagle assigned to the 144th Fighter Wing, Fresno Air National Guard Base, Calif., taxis on the Nellis Air Force Base, Nev. runway, Feb. 2, 2016, as part of Red Flag 16-1. Red Flag is a realistic combat training exercise which involves air, space and cyber forces from the U.S. and its allies. (U.S. Air National Guard photo by Senior Airman Klynne Pearl Serrano)
